If the damage is limited to a few panels, repair is usually the right call. Widespread cracking, warping,
or moisture behind the wall means a full replacement is the better investment for your NJ home.
Vinyl and fiber cement siding both perform well in NJ’s mix of heat, cold, humidity, and storm seasons.
We’ll walk you through the options based on your home’s specific needs and budget.
Most NJ residential siding projects finish in two to four days. We protect exposed areas between
workdays and keep the site clean so your property stays livable throughout the job.
Wind and hail damage to siding is typically covered under standard homeowners policies. We inspect,
document, and assist with your insurance claim at no extra cost, just like we do for roofing projects.
